Boulevardier
Rich and intriguing, the bittersweet Boulevardier - also known as the Negroni’s autumnal cousin - is ideal for getting things warmed up during the festive season. Simple and easy to make, making it a perfect option if you’re hosting a Christmas or New Year’s party. Simply combine orange liqueur, sweet vermouth and peaty Ardberg whisky, add a couple of ice cubes to freshen things up and stir well. Garnish with a swirl of orange peel, and it’s ready you’re good to go.
How to mix a Boulevardier – the step-by-step recipe
- Add orange liqueur, sweet vermouth and Ardberg whisky to a rock glass.
- Place two ice cubes in the glass.
- Stir well.
- Garnish with a rolled orange twist.
Accessories
- Size jigger
- Bar spoon
Glassware
- Rock glass
Ingredients
- 35 mL / 1 ¼ oz Ardberg whisky
- 30 mL / 1 oz orange liqueur
- 30 mL / 1 oz sweet vermouth
Garnish
- 1 orange twist
